Overview

SZA's music is a breath of fresh air in the R&B scene, with her unique blend of soul, hip-hop, and electronic elements. As noted by music critics like Rolling Stone's Rob Sheffield and Pitchfork's Stacey Anderson, SZA's sound is more experimental and genre-bending than traditional R&B music. In contrast, traditional R&B music, as seen in artists like The Weeknd, Usher, and Chris Brown, tends to focus on smooth, soulful vocals and catchy melodies, often with a more commercial appeal, similar to the sounds of legendary R&B groups like Boyz II Men and TLC.

📊 Side-by-Side Comparison

A detailed comparison of SZA and R&B music reveals some key differences. SZA's music often features complex, atmospheric production, similar to the sounds of electronic artists like Four Tet and Burial, while traditional R&B music tends to focus on more straightforward, radio-friendly production, often incorporating elements from hip-hop and pop, as seen in artists like Drake and Ariana Grande. Additionally, SZA's lyrics often explore themes of introspection, self-discovery, and social justice, similar to the lyrical themes of artists like J. Cole and Chance the Rapper, while traditional R&B music tends to focus on more traditional themes of love, relationships, and heartbreak, often with a more sensual and romantic tone, similar to the sounds of R&B legends like Prince and Marvin Gaye.
